On Education.com, this page provides 3rd grade common core compare and contrast resources including worksheets, lesson plans, and classroom activities. These materials help students identify similarities and differences in themes, settings, and plots in fiction and nonfiction texts using signal words, Venn diagrams, and color coding strategies. Educators and parents can access structured resources to reinforce critical thinking and reading comprehension skills aligned with common core standards.
The Resources section offers printable activities, digital practice exercises, and graphic organizers designed to make compare and contrast concepts engaging for 3rd grade students. Materials include leveled passages, task cards, chart templates, and interactive games that support a variety of teaching styles and learning preferences. These resources make it easy to create lessons that help students analyze texts and develop analytical skills.
This collection enables teachers and parents to plan and conduct lessons that teach students to compare characters, settings, and plots across multiple texts. With ready-to-use materials, learners can practice identifying key similarities and differences, enhancing their reading comprehension and critical thinking.
